Many do not believe that the coronavirus exists in CAR. I believe it. When you arrive at my house, we greet you from a distance and we direct you to wash your hands. When I go to the office, I put on my mask, and when I come home from my workday, my children say to me: “Mom, wash your hands!”. I raise awareness around me.
Defending the interests of women is important in CAR. Customs and traditions weigh on women, and they cannot speak out. I have been marginalized and underestimated. People think that all I care for is studying and work, and that family life does not interest me.
What helps me hold on is to stay focused on my goal to become a public figure. I hope that one day this dream will come true, and that I can make big decisions to change the lives of women in my country.
